ModelValidationState Énumération
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
État de validation d’un ModelStateEntry instance.
ModelValidationState de Root est utilisé pour déterminer la validité de ModelStateDictionary.
IsValid est true
, lorsque la validité agrégée (GetFieldValidationState(String)) du nœud racine est Valid.
public enum class ModelValidationState
public enum ModelValidationState
type ModelValidationState =
Public Enum ModelValidationState
- Héritage
-
ModelValidationState
Champs
Invalid | 1 | La validation a été effectuée sur le ModelStateEntry et n’est pas valide. Pour la validité agrégée, la validation d’un ModelStateEntry est si l’entrée ou l’un des descendants est et aucun n’est InvalidUnvalidated.Invalid |
Skipped | 3 | La validation a été ignorée pour le ModelStateEntry. La validité agrégée d’une entrée n’est jamais Skipped. |
Unvalidated | 0 | La validation n’a pas été effectuée sur le ModelStateEntry. Pour la validité agrégée, la validation d’un ModelStateEntry est Unvalidated si l’entrée ou l’un desdescendants est Unvalidated. |
Valid | 2 | La validation a été effectuée sur le ModelStateEntry Pour la validité agrégée, la validation d’un ModelStateEntry est si la validité de l’entrée et de tous les descendants est ou ValidSkipped.Valid |